A Desert Storm memorial in Huntington Beach, California. The plaque is full of typos and grammar mistakes. Someone did not proofread.

Photos taken on 10 September 2022. The plaque says, "Ode to Desert Storm

My God we are proud Mr. President,
Mr. Cheney and Colin and Norm.
For you and our troops in the Persian Gulf,
For your accomplishments in Desert Storm.

We're also proud of Reagan and Cap,
Who knew what had to be done.
On their "Watch" they rebuilt our forces,
And for that We're again number one.

We've blown the sock off of Saddam,
His chemical, nuke plants and tanks.
We fought the war to win it,
And for that our everlasting thanks.

Desert Shield turned storm and lighting did strike,
To throw out Saddam the fool.
And rid Kuwait of all the pain,
Brought on by Satan's tool.

The women and men, both young and old
Who fought for the red, white and blue,
Are the greatest and best of the U.S.A.,
And that's no brag it's just true.

The cruise, the bradly, the M-1 tank,
Brought hell fire to all in their way,
Our troops and our allies, went arm and arm,
They made Saddam Really Pay.

Yes, thunder and lighting is what they were,
Just like Norman said they would be,
And now we know the battle was right,
Cause Kuwait and it's people are free.

We come here today to plant this great oak,
In honor of Desert Storm,
For the peace with freedom they won for us all,
And especially for those not yet born.

We sent our love and shed our tears,
For our wounded and those who died,
May God grant their loved ones and families,
With Heavenly comfort and pride.
